Working Hours : 8 : 00am-17 : 00 or 9 : 00am-18 : 00 / Mon to Fri Job Summary This position is responsible for performing administrative duties in human resources function in accurate efficient and timely manner including payroll processing benefit administration and personnel record filing. This position also supports HR Manager in clerical HR-related tasks as requested. Essential Job Functions ーPayroll Administration Compile or update payroll data such as pay rate personnel or personal information time & attendance records benefit deduction while verifying completeness and accuracy. Communicate and report any payroll information change tax information and other base data required for each payroll to payroll outsourcing company in a timely manner by email fax or telephone. Correspond to the employees regarding payroll inquiries and resolve payroll discrepancies by collecting and analyzing data. Reconcile payroll-related activity and interact with outsourcing companies to clear reconciling items& balance current month-to-date and year-to-date payroll registers. • Benefit Administration Enter and update the employee information upon events using the benefits management system. Act as liaison between employees insurance providers or brokers in enrollment or termination administration and to resolve benefit related problems and ensure effective utilization of plans and positive employee relations. Prepare benefits invoices reconcile against withholding reports and process for management review and payment. • Employee Hiring & Onboarding and Separation Administration Support HR Manager in the hiring process including researching the appropriate recruiting sources initiating background checks preparing documents for new hires and assisting new-hire orientation as well. Conduct new hire orientation and process hiring-related paperwork ensuring that all hiring documents such as I-9 and payroll documents for new hires are received in a timely manner. Prepare and process all separation documents while contacting external vendors when necessary. • Filing & Record keeping Create employee files and file all personnel related documents including staffing recruitment training grievances performance evaluations in each employees personnel and confidential folders. Maintain historical human resource records by designing a filing and retrieval system & keeping past and current records. Administer workplace posters and notices ensuring that federal state and local employment posters and subscriptions are ordered and posted appropriately in each office and store.
